This week I present the repair and restoration of an antique display cabinet that I found on the side of the road while walking home from the gym. It is approximately 100 years old and was constructed by a local furniture maker which is of course no longer in business. It was falling apart, chipped, broken, and missing glass panes but overall in fair shape. It had five layers of paint, at least one of them being lead paint, and old, crusty varnish.
This project required removal of the lead paint, filling 10,000 nail holes, repairing chipped wooden legs, wood working, sanding, staining and finishing, and assembly.
